Packaging label for Trip Ease Homeopathic Motion Sickness Relief, containing 32 tablets. The label states the product is made in New Zealand and distributed by Miers Laboratories. It features an orange background with images of a train, car, and cruise ship, emphasizing motion sickness relief. The label includes a Drug Facts panel listing active and inactive ingredients, usage directions, warnings, and storage information.*
